Plants have developed all sorts of tactics to stop themselves from getting eaten. But they can't stop the mighty sloth. Sloths have adapted to eat plants that would otherwise be poisonous to other animals.

How Nature Works
Secrets of Our Living Planet showcases the incredible ecosystems that make life on Earth possible. Using intricately shot natural footage, Chris Packham reveals the hidden wonder of the creatures that we share the planet with, and the intricate, clever and bizarre connections between the species, without which life just could not survive. From the rainforests of Brazil, through the fertile plains of Kenya and out into the wintry wilds of North America, Packham shows us the natural world like it has never been seen before.
